ĆevapiSarajevo, Bosnia & Herzegovina · easy · 40 minHand-rolled grilled beef fingers tucked into pillowy somun with raw onion and kajmak, Sarajevo’s pride.
Uštipci with KajmakSarajevo, Bosnia & Herzegovina · easy · 35 minLittle fried dough balls served warm with kajmak clotted cream and soft cheese.
Begova ČorbaSarajevo, Bosnia & Herzegovina · medium · 70 minA rich, velvety chicken and okra soup finished with a sour cream and egg yolk liaison, the noble Bey's soup of Bosnian cuisine.
TufahijeSarajevo, Bosnia & Herzegovina · medium · 55 minWhole apples poached in syrup and stuffed with sweet walnuts, topped with cream, an elegant Ottoman-Bosnian sweet.
Bosanski LonacSarajevo, Bosnia & Herzegovina · easy · 240 minThe "Bosnian pot": chunks of beef and vegetables layered raw in a tall pot and slow-cooked for hours into a rich stew.
Sogan-dolmaSarajevo, Bosnia & Herzegovina · medium · 110 minA Sarajevo trademark: single onion layers wrapped around spiced minced beef and rice, braised soft and served with sour cream.
